Windows 10 by default allows you to login with the help of Microsoft account. This is the same account you should be using for different other purposes like checking your email. Let us explain how to setup local account login in Windows 10 so that you can login to your laptop without linking to your Microsoft account.
Press “Windows Key” or click on the start button. Click on the “Settings” from the start menu and then click on the “Accounts” section.
By default you will be on the first tab “Your email and accounts” or else go to the first section. When you are there, click on the link saying, “Sign in with a local account instead”.
You will be prompted to enter your Microsoft account password which is used currently to unlock the laptop. Enter the current password to proceed further.
On next screen, enter the new username, password and password hint for a local admin setup. The password hint will be used to retrieve the password when you have forgotten.
Click “Next” and then finally click on the “Sign out and Finish” button to logout of the laptop.
The login screen will look like below. You should use your new local account password to login to the laptop from now onwards.
The local account password setup will help to boot the laptop comparatively faster than using Microsoft account password. Ensure to create good and complex password that is unique and easier to memorize. When you enter wrong password, Windows will automatically show the password hint you have provided during the setup.
You can use the “Reset password” wizard only if you have the password reset disk created before. Otherwise there is no way to recover the local account password other than resetting your PC.
Change Password for Local Account
You can change the local account password anytime by going to “Start Menu > Settings > Accounts > Sign-in options”. And click on the “Change” button under “Password” section.
You need to enter the current login password for proceeding further. Enter new password and hint to setup a new password for your local account.
Switching Back to Login with Microsoft Account
Once you setup the local account, Windows 10 will forget the previous Microsoft account used on the laptop. In order to setup the login account with your Microsoft account, go to “Start Menu > Settings > Accounts > Your email and accounts” section. Click on the “Sign-in with a Microsoft account instead”.
Provide your Microsoft email and password to setup login. Now you should use your Microsoft account password for unlocking the computer like before.
